    Well I talked to Al on the phone this morning and went over the measurement differences with him and he told me that was what he expected. They already are working on shorter versions to work with revolver cartridges (revolver cartridge dies have a short expander and a long shoulder section inside the dies, auto cartridge dies have a long expander and a short shoulder section)

    So I will be anxiously awaiting the new ones.

    NOE is doing two types. One is for use with the Lee Universal Expanding Die (which is really a flaring die) and the second is for the Lee Powder Through Expanding die. I have a few for the Universal Expanding Die and intend to get more for the Powder Through Expanding die, which is also really a flaring die as well. With the NOE inserts, both are great expanding dies for cast bullets.

    Yup, had the same problem. Took a picture, sent it and Al responded sorry for the inconvenience we are working on short ones as we speak. The two for .38 calibers were 38AP and 38P. The AP designation was for autos and the P for revolvers. The autos work fine the revolver ones are too long. The ones I ordered for the Lee universal expander for rifles work great.
